Ticket FM-2281: The summer intern cohort for Brightlea Analytics arrives Monday at the Fennel Street office. Twelve interns total, starting in the third-floor open area. Team assistants should collect welcome packs from the mailroom before 9:00 and escort interns from the lobby. Temporary badges are pre-printed; desks are labelled. Until individual badges are activated, escorts should use the shared door-pass code below.

door code, bageg-bajof: bdg-IU-0

Welcome to on-call for Hopperline's bounce processor! Most weeks it just hums along sorting hard bounces from soft ones. If the worker won't start, it's almost always a missing env var. Copy `.env.sample` to `.env`, fill in the queue host, and then add the line that sets the mailbox token, shown below.

env line for fafof-fahag: LEDGER_TOKEN5=f8790

## Step 4: Switch crash uploads to the new Fennelworks pipeline

Almost done! Support folks, this is the step where old crash reports stop flowing to Driftlog and start landing in Fennelworks. Users on app versions below 4.2 will still show up in the legacy queue for about two weeks — that's expected. Once the cutover flag flips, the pipeline reads the following settings.

deployment values, kajep-kageg:
[praix]
host = praix.paliqcorp.corp
user = praix_svc
database = praix_prod

Subject: Gateway release handover

Hi team — handing over release duties for the Meridian gateway. Rate-limit configs ship with each release; validate the quota tables against staging traffic before promotion. Releases must be signed or the rollout controller refuses them. The signing key you'll need for the next cut is below.

signing key of kahog-kadup = bky13_6wLyxnPsJob4P

## Formula sandbox tuning

User-supplied formulas in Gridmoor execute inside a restricted interpreter with hard ceilings on time, memory, and call depth. Reviewers should confirm any change to these ceilings is justified in the PR description, since raising them widens the abuse surface. Defaults were chosen from production traces. The current limits are as follows.

limits module of tafog-fawip:
WEIGHTS = {
    "julix": 57,
    "lamys": 992,
    "kasvan": 209,
    "quenok": 750,
    "alddor": 259,
    "oliath": 1009,
    "wenix": 815,
}